Gravel roof rep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to gravel-covered roofing systems, which are commonly used on commercial, industrial, and some residential properties. These services typically include inspecting the roof for damage or deterioration, replacing or adding gravel as needed, and repairing underlying materials such as the roofing membrane or insulation. The goal is to restore the roof’s protective layer, prevent leaks, and extend its lifespan, ensuring the structure remains secure and weather-resistant.

Problems that gravel roof repair aims to resolve often include gravel displacement or loss, cracks, tears, or punctures in the roofing membrane, and areas of pooling water or leaks. Over time, gravel can shift or wash away due to wind, rain, or foot traffic, exposing the underlying layers to potential damage. Additionally, aging or damaged membranes can develop leaks or become less effective at preventing water intrusion. Repair services address these issues to maintain the roof’s integrity and prevent more costly repairs or replacements in the future.

The types of properties that typically utilize gravel roof repair services are primarily commercial buildings, such as warehouses, factories, and retail centers, which often feature flat or low-slope roofs with gravel surfacing. Some larger residential buildings or multi-family complexes may also have gravel roofs that require maintenance or repair. These properties benefit from professional repair services to ensure the roof remains durable and functional, especially given the exposure to harsh weather conditions and the importance of protecting valuable assets inside.

What causes gravel roof damage? Gravel roofs can be damaged by weather elements, foot traffic, or aging materials, leading to potential leaks or deterioration.

How do I know if my gravel roof needs repairs? Signs include missing gravel, pooling water, cracks, or visible damage to the surface that may indicate the need for professional assessment.

What types of repairs are common for gravel roofs? Common repairs include replacing or adding gravel, fixing cracks or punctures, and addressing underlying membrane issues.

Can gravel roofs be repaired without complete replacement? Yes, many issues can be addressed through targeted repairs, which may extend the roof's lifespan without a full replacement.
